Differing from other data communications books, this one emphasizes the logic behind the design process. It discusses design principles in order to provide guidelines for the design of protocols that are logically consistent. For courses in data communications, operating systems, or protocol design. This volume discusses the fundamental problems of designing logically consistent methods of communication between multiple computer processes. Standard protocol design problems, such as error control and flow control, are covered in detail, but also structured design methods and the construction of formal validation models. The book contains complete listings and explanations of new protocol validation and design tool called SPIN. Author is in charge of protocol design at Bell Labs.
